Subject: [PATCH 05/10] mdadm/tests: wait until level changes
Date: Wed, 28 Aug 2024 10:11:45 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240828021150.63240-6-xni@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20240828021150.63240-1-xni@redhat.com>

check wait waits reshape finishes, but it doesn't wait level changes.
The level change happens in a forked child progress. So we need to
search the child progress and monitor it.

Signed-off-by: Xiao Ni <xni@redhat.com>
---
 tests/05r6tor0 | 4 ++++
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)

diff --git a/tests/05r6tor0 b/tests/05r6tor0
index 2fd51f2ea4bb..b2685b721c2e 100644
--- a/tests/05r6tor0
+++ b/tests/05r6tor0
@@ -13,6 +13,10 @@ check raid5
 testdev $md0 3 19456 512
 mdadm -G $md0 -l0
 check wait; sleep 1
+while ps auxf | grep "mdadm -G" | grep -v grep
+do
+        sleep 1
+done
 check raid0
 testdev $md0 3 19456 512
 mdadm -G $md0 -l5 --add $dev3 $dev4
